Resistiré is a 2003 Argentine telenovela. This serial features a gorgeous woman torn between her terrorist fiancee and a handsome tailor. It starred Pablo Echarri, Celeste Cid, Carolina Fal and Fabián Vena. Resistiré was a major hit on Argentinian television. It dared to introduce new elements in the genre of telenovela and was well accepted by the audience, setting a new standard in TV. In 2004, the telenovela won the Martín Fierro Award as the best show of the year, along with many other awards. In 2006, two remakes debuted. MyNetworkTV produced an American version in English titled Watch Over Me. In addition, Televisa unveiled Amar Sin Limites for Mexican viewers.

Film based on the life of Dr. Salvador Mazza, who, with a group of professionals, conducts an investigation to discover the antidote to a mysterious illness whose carrier is a nocturnal insect. A Mazza was regarded as the first doctor who fought the deadly Chagas disease in Argentina.
